The Different Types of Fridges
Understanding the types of refrigerators offered is essential when it comes to making an informed purchase. Here's a breakdown of the most common kinds of refrigerators in the UK:
Type of FridgeDescriptionProsConsLeading Freezer fridge and freezerA traditional design featuring a freezer compartment on top of the fridge.Normally more cost effective; classic design.Can require flexing down to gain access to fresh food.Bottom Freezer FridgeThe fresh food compartment is at eye level while the freezer is on the bottom.Simpler access to fresh food; often more energy-efficient.Normally costlier than top freezer models.Side-by-Side FridgeFunctions 2 vertical compartments-- one for fresh foods and one for frozen foods-- frequently with a water and ice dispenser.Adequate storage area; hassle-free for households.Takes up more kitchen area space; can be pricey.French Door FridgeCombines a bottom freezer with two doors for fresh food, offering a trendy look and roomy interior.Outstanding for big families; spacious shelves.Greater price point; needs ample space.Compact FridgeA little, space-saving alternative suitable for dormitory or offices.Best for small spaces; low energy usage.Restricted storage capacity; does not have freezer area.Integrated FridgeDeveloped into kitchen cabinets, offering a smooth look.Aesthetic appeal; space-saving style.Often more costly; can be challenging to repair.Key Features to Consider
When picking a fridge, numerous key functions should be taken into account to guarantee that it meets your requirements and fits your way of life:

Energy Efficiency: Look for A+ to A+++ ranked designs to lower energy costs and environmental impact.

Capability: Assess the size of your home and select a fridge with a proper capacity. A family of 4 may need around 300-400 litres of storage.

Temperature Zones: High-end designs frequently come with various cooling zones, suitable for preserving various kinds of food.

Smart Technology: Some refrigerators come with smart features, permitting you to control settings through an app, which can be especially helpful for keeping an eye on food freshness.

Sound Level: Consider the decibel ranking if your kitchen is close to living or sleeping locations.

Extra Features: Look for alternatives like water dispensers, ice makers, or custom shelving to boost functionality.

FAQs About Fridges in the UKWhat is the average lifespan of a fridge?
The typical life-span of a fridge freezers uk sale is typically between 10 to 20 years, depending upon the design and how well it is kept.
How do I keep my fridge?
Frequently tidy the racks, guarantee the seals are undamaged, and change the temperature level settings to maintain ideal efficiency.
Can fridges be fixed, or should I change them?
Small problems, such as a defective thermostat, can often be fixed. However, if the fridge is over 10 years old and requires significant repair work, replacing it may be more affordable.
